Launch of the Tropical Rainfall Measuring Mission (TRMM) Satellite
Primary Topic: 
Type: 
Audience: 
Summary: 
This video shows the launch of the Tropical Rainfall Measuring Mission (TRMM) satellite on November 27th, 1997 from Tanegashima Space Center in Japan. TRMM was launched on JAXA's H-IIA rocket.
